数据加载与保存:CSV, Excel, JSON, SQL 等常见格式

各位观众老爷,各位程序猿、程序媛,以及未来可能成为程序猿、程序媛的潜力股们,大家好!我是你们的老朋友,人称“代码段子手”的程序猿老王。今天,咱们就来聊聊编程世界里的“吃喝拉撒”——数据加载与保存! 🍚 💩 别误会,我说的“吃喝拉撒”可不是真的吃饭喝水上厕所,而是指程序从外部“吃”进数据(加载),以及把处理后的数据“拉”出去(保存)。数据是程序的血液,没有血液,程序就只能变成一堆冰冷的机器码,毫无生机。 咱们今天的主题是:CSV, Excel, JSON, SQL 等常见格式的数据加载与保存。 各位有没有觉得,这些格式就像我们餐桌上的菜肴? CSV 像清淡的小米粥,Excel 像丰盛的满汉全席,JSON 像精致的日式料理,SQL 就像地道的川菜火锅。每种格式都有它的特点,适用场景也各不相同。 废话不多说,咱们开始上菜! 👨‍🍳 一、CSV:轻便灵活的小米粥 CSV(Comma Separated Values),顾名思义,就是用逗号分隔数值的文本文件。它就像小米粥一样,简单、轻便、灵活,但营养也够用。 优点: 简单易懂: 用记事本就能打开,一览无余。 体积小: 相对于其他格式,CSV 文 …

数据加载与保存:CSV, Excel, JSON, SQL 等常见格式

好的,各位观众老爷们,各位编程界的弄潮儿们,欢迎来到老司机我——人称“代码界的段子手”的课堂!今天,咱们要聊聊数据这玩意儿,以及如何像驯服野马一样,把它们加载进来,再像珍藏古董一样,小心翼翼地保存好。 主题是什么?当然是:数据加载与保存:CSV, Excel, JSON, SQL 等常见格式。 别害怕,我知道一听到这些名词,有些人就开始打哈欠了。但相信我,这绝对比你看《霸道总裁爱上我》更有意思,因为这是你驰骋数据海洋,成为数据大航海家必备的技能!😎 第一幕:数据,无处不在的“小妖精” 数据,这玩意儿,就像空气一样,无处不在。你每天刷的抖音,看的淘宝,用的微信,背后都离不开数据的支撑。它们记录着你的喜好,你的行为,甚至你的秘密。 数据就像一个个“小妖精”,它们形态各异,性格古怪。有的像规规矩矩的表格,有的像乱麻一样的文本,有的像深奥的密码,等着我们去破解。 所以,掌握数据的加载和保存,就相当于拥有了“御妖术”,能把这些“小妖精”玩弄于股掌之间。 第二幕:数据格式大观园,各领风骚数百年 既然“小妖精”们性格各异,那它们的“住所”自然也五花八门。我们常见的“住所”有以下几种: CSV (Co …

Excel 自动化:OpenPyXL 与 Pandas 处理 Excel 文件

好的,各位观众老爷,各位未来的Excel武林盟主!今天咱们就来聊聊如何用Python这把倚天剑,配合OpenPyXL和Pandas这两大内功心法,玩转Excel江湖!🚀 咱们的目标是:不再做Excel表里的打工人,而是成为Excel表的主宰者!😎 开场白:Excel,爱恨交织的你啊! 话说这Excel,真是让人又爱又恨。爱的是它功能强大,制表、统计、分析,样样精通;恨的是,手动操作起来,那真是费时费力,让人头昏眼花。尤其当数据量一大,那感觉就像在汪洋大海里捞针,捞到最后,怀疑人生!🤯 作为一名优秀的程序员,怎么能忍受这种重复性的劳动呢?所以,我们要用Python来解放双手,让Excel乖乖听话! 第一章:内功心法之OpenPyXL OpenPyXL,顾名思义,就是“打开Python,处理Excel”的意思。它是一个Python库,专门用来读写Excel 2010 xlsx/xlsm/xltx/xltm文件。你可以把它想象成一把锋利的手术刀,能够精确地定位到Excel的每一个单元格,进行切割、缝合、填充等操作。 安装OpenPyXL:磨刀不误砍柴工 在使用OpenPyXL之前,我们需要先 …